Leg 1: South Florida +5.5

In recent news, Louisville’s freshman point guard and future top-10 NBA draft selection, Mikel Brown Jr., has been ruled out for the entire first weekend of the NCAA Tournament.

Even prior to the injury report, the East Region’s 11th-seeded South Florida Bulls had already been one of the most popular upset selections in the first round to prevail over Pat Kelsey’s Cardinals, who have struggled mightily down the stretch.

While I was a long-term believer in Kelsey’s bunch, I now have zero faith in the Cardinals without their freshman phenom.

I actually see value on the other side, with South Florida catching over five points against a Louisville team without its floor general and primary facilitator.

South Florida is on a tear, winning 11 consecutive games entering the NCAA Tournament.

While I was initially skeptical about their chances, I hopped on the Bulls' bandwagon as soon as the Brown news broke.

Leg 2: Ryan Conwell 20+ Points

In SGPs, one of the best approaches to extracting max value is often to pair the side you favor with a player prop from the other team’s roster in a negative-correlation parlay, which magnifies the price of the same-game parlay.

I'm taking that approach ahead of Thursday's East Region matchup, pairing South Florida +5.5 with the Cardinals’ second-best scorer, Ryan Conwell, to score at least 20 points. The Xavier transfer has thrived this season without Brown on the floor.

Action PRO projects Conwell for 24.3 points on Thursday, an A- grade pick with a 17.4% edge against the market when compared to his current prop line of over/under 21.5 points.
